Ответ:

Основным занятием тюрков было кочевое скотоводство, а также охота на травоядных животных, носившая характер облавы ввиду многочисленности стад степных зверей. Основной пищей тюрков было мясо, любимым напитком — кумыс. Одежда и шатры шились из шкур животных. Тюрки также изготавливали войлок и шерстяные ткани. Основным видом скота были овцы и лошади. Основной экономической единицей была парная (аильная) семья.

Types of Livestock Farming among the Turks and the Reasons

The Turks have historically practiced various types of livestock farming. The specific types of livestock farming among the Turks can vary depending on the region and historical period. Here are some examples:

1. Nomadic Pastoralism: Nomadic pastoralism is a traditional form of livestock farming practiced by many Turkic groups. Nomadic pastoralists move their herds of livestock, such as sheep, goats, and horses, in search of fresh grazing lands. This lifestyle allows them to utilize different pastures throughout the year and adapt to changing environmental conditions.

2. Transhumance: Transhumance is another form of livestock farming practiced by the Turks. Transhumance involves the seasonal movement of livestock between different altitudes or regions. For example, during the summer, herders may move their animals to higher mountain pastures, while in the winter, they may bring them down to lower elevations for shelter and better access to resources.

3. Sedentary Livestock Farming: In addition to nomadic and transhumant practices, sedentary livestock farming is also common among the Turks. This involves keeping livestock in fixed locations, such as villages or settlements, and providing them with regular care and feeding. Sedentary livestock farming allows for more controlled breeding and management of the animals.

The reasons for these different types of livestock farming among the Turks are influenced by various factors, including:

- Geography and Climate: The diverse geography and climate of the regions inhabited by the Turks have shaped their livestock farming practices. Nomadic pastoralism and transhumance, for example, are well-suited to the vast grasslands and mountainous regions of Central Asia, where the Turks originated.

- Cultural and Historical Traditions: Livestock farming has been an integral part of Turkic cultures for centuries. The nomadic and semi-nomadic lifestyle, including the practice of moving with herds, has been deeply ingrained in their cultural identity. These traditions have been passed down through generations and continue to be practiced today.

- Availability of Resources: The availability of natural resources, such as grazing lands and water sources, also influences the choice of livestock farming practices. Nomadic and transhumant practices allow the Turks to utilize different pastures and ensure the sustainability of their herds by avoiding overgrazing in a particular area.

- Economic Considerations: Livestock farming has historically been an important economic activity for the Turks. It provides a source of food, clothing, and other essential products. The mobility of nomadic and transhumant practices also allows for trade and exchange with neighboring communities, contributing to the economic well-being of the Turks.

In conclusion, the Turks have practiced various types of livestock farming, including nomadic pastoralism, transhumance, and sedentary farming. These practices are influenced by factors such as geography, climate, cultural traditions, resource availability, and economic considerations.
